Forecast: Import of Tool Holders and Self-Opening Dieheads, for Machine Tools to the UK

The import of tool holders and self-opening dieheads for machine tools to the UK is forecasted to show a slight decrease from 2024 through 2028, with values dropping from 1.6772 to 1.6561 million kilograms respectively. This represents a consistent downward trend, resulting in a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) reflecting a minor decline. The data from 2023 shows an uptrend leading into 2024, providing a year-on-year variation backdrop that supports this forecasted decline.

Future trends to watch for include:

  • Technological advancements in manufacturing that could reduce reliance on imports.
  • Potential trade policy adjustments post-Brexit impacting import patterns.
  • Shifts in domestic production capacity influencing demand for imported machine tool components.
